Turning Space into a Transportation Layer for Earth Who We Are:
Inversion builds advanced reentry systems to deliver next-generation capabilities from space. Our mission is to make Earth radically more accessible by turning Low-Earth Orbit into an on-demand logistics domain. We see space not as a destination, but as a platform — one that unlocks unprecedented speed and global reach. Our spacecraft are designed to deliver payloads anywhere on Earth in under an hour, operating through extreme reentry conditions and landing with high precision. These systems open the door to new ways of testing, delivering, and operating at hypersonic speeds. Inherently dual-use, our technology is built to meet urgent national security needs while laying the groundwork for future commercial applications. Backed by leading investors including Y Combinator, Spark Capital, and Lockheed Martin Ventures, and working with partners such as the U.S. Space Force and NASA, Inversion is pushing the boundaries of what’s possible in space-based defense and logistics.
What You'll Do
As a Senior Test Engineer at Inversion, you will own the planning and execution of critical mechanical test campaign s for one of the most capable reentry vehicles ever developed. You’ll lead testing from early component and subsystem development through integrated demonstration, working closely with design, analysis, manufacturing, and external test partners to retire risk and validate system performance.
This is a unique opportunity to build and lead high-consequence mechanical test campaign s for a new aerospace vehicle from early development through qualification and production. You will be a key member of the Mechanical team, reporting to the Director of Mechanical.
Key Responsibilities
Own the planning and execution of component, subsystem, and system-level test campaigns supporting deployment and separation mechanism development
Lead complex test campaigns to demonstrate system performance under representative environments
Develop test plans, procedures, success criteria, and test readiness documentation for mechanical development and validation activities
Coordinate closely with external test facilities and vendors to define test requirements, facility interfaces, schedules, constraints, and execution plans
Design and develop test fixtures, adapters, support equipment, and other GSE required to safely and effectively execute testing
Partner with structures, mechanisms, dynamics, and manufacturing engineers to ensure test articles, fixtures, and instrumentation support key technical objectives
Define instrumentation and data collection needs in collaboration with internal and external partners to ensure test results can validate performance and inform model correlation
Drive test campaign logistics including hardware readiness, facility integration, procedural development, configuration tracking, and execution coordination
Lead troubleshooting and issue resolution during test preparation and execution, and drive rapid turnaround on test learnings into follow-on hardware or procedures
Author test reports and communicate results, risks, and recommended next steps in design reviews and cross-functional program forums
